Start With Licensing and Ownership

Regulation should be the first checkpoint. A reputable casino clearly identifies its operating company, licence details, customer-support channels, and applicable terms. This information should be easy to find rather than hidden behind vague claims about being “trusted” or “secure”.

Players should also check whether the licence covers their location. Rules differ between jurisdictions, especially around advertising, identity checks, bonuses, and dispute procedures. A platform that refuses to explain its regulatory position is best treated cautiously.

Compare Games, Providers, and Mobile Performance

Game quantity can create a misleading impression. A catalogue containing thousands of titles may include many near-identical slots, while a smaller lobby can offer better variety across table games, live casino, jackpots, and video poker. The important question is whether the selection matches your preferences.

Provider information adds another layer of confidence. Recognised studios generally publish game rules, return-to-player figures, volatility descriptions, and maximum-win details. These figures do not guarantee a result, but they make the mathematical character of a game easier to understand.

Mobile usability should be tested as seriously as desktop design. Menus should load quickly, buttons must be large enough to use comfortably, and game sessions should remain stable when a connection changes. A responsive site is helpful, but a dedicated application is not automatically superior.

Analyse Bonuses Without Chasing the Headline

Promotional offers deserve careful reading. A large welcome figure may be divided into several stages, restricted to selected games, or tied to a wagering requirement that significantly changes its practical value. The headline amount is only one part of the offer.

Bonus detail Why it matters
Wagering requirement Shows how many times qualifying funds must be played through.
Game contribution Explains whether slots, tables, or live games count equally.
Maximum bet May affect eligibility while the promotion is active.
Expiry period Defines how long the player has to complete the conditions.
Withdrawal limits Can restrict the amount collected from certain offers.

Responsible comparison means calculating the likely value rather than pursuing every promotion. A no-deposit reward, for example, may involve strict verification and limited withdrawals. Read the full terms, including restrictions placed on cash deposits, before opting in.

Review Banking and Withdrawal Standards

Payment quality is often more important than promotional design. A suitable operator should explain deposit methods, processing times, minimum and maximum limits, fees, and verification requirements. It should also make clear whether the withdrawal method must match the original funding source.

Fast deposits do not necessarily indicate fast withdrawals. Look for a separate withdrawal policy and identify any pending period, manual review, or document request. Reputable services explain why checks are required and provide a realistic timeframe instead of promising instant access in every case.

Use Safety Tools as Part of the Decision

Responsible gambling features are central to a credible casino. Useful controls include deposit limits, loss limits, session reminders, time-outs, reality checks, and self-exclusion. These options should be visible in the account area and supported by clear information about external help.

Final Checklist for a Confident Choice

The best casino is not necessarily the one with the biggest bonus or the longest game list. It is the platform whose licence, terms, payments, support, and safety tools can be understood without guesswork. Compare several operators, save copies of important conditions, and begin only with an amount you can comfortably afford to lose.

This approach turns selection into an informed process rather than an impulse decision. Transparent information cannot remove the natural uncertainty of casino games, but it can reduce avoidable surprises and support a more controlled form of online entertainment.
